in calfornia you can not legally have any tint (of any degree) on your front drivers and passengers side door windows... this law has always been in the books since 1983 but was never really enforced... due to years of cut backs they have started to write tickets for the past two years. it is still at officers descretion but they can legally give you a ticket for any degree of tint on those two front door glass. so why risk it.. but if its oem it is legal. since most people know that hondas dont come tinted from the factory as compared to most bmw's vw's mercedes etc they are not looked at too closely. https://honda-tech.com/forums/images...s/emthdown.gif

also remember if you have tint on your rear window you must have a passenger side rear side mirror.
